The fiscal year 2024 limit for family-sponsored preference immigrants determined in accordance with Section 201 of the Immigration and Nationality Act (INA) is 226,000. The worldwide level for annual employment-based preference immigrants is at least 140,000. Section 202 prescribes that the per-country limit for preference immigrants is set ... Right now I am looking at the Visa Bulletin for October 2011 and they are processing petitions filed as of May 1, 2001.The CSPA formula allows the time that the visa petition was pending to be subtracted from the child’s age when the priority date becomes current. For example: A beneficiary’s priority date becomes current on their 25th birthday after the visa petition was pending for 5 years. Fiscal Year 2017. March 2017 - IV Issuances by FSC or Place of Birth and Visa Class.The fiscal year 2023 limit for employment-based preference immigrants calculated under INA 201 is 197,091. Section 202 prescribes that the per-country limit for preference immigrants is set at 7% of the total annual family-sponsored and employment-based preference limits, i.e., 29,616 for FY-2023. The dependent area limit is set at 2%, ….
